Factors Influencing How Often AC Should Be Serviced

Several factors determine how often you should service your AC. These variables ensure your unit operates efficiently and lasts longer.

Type of Air Conditioning System

Your AC’s type affects its maintenance schedule. Central air systems require servicing at least once a year to clean ducts and check refrigerant levels. Split systems benefit from biannual checkups to inspect indoor and outdoor units. Window units need servicing annually to clean filters and coils. Each system’s complexity and components dictate the frequency of professional inspections and tune-ups.

Usage Frequency and Environment

How often you run your AC impacts service frequency. Heavy use during long summers demands more frequent maintenance, typically twice a year. Light use in milder climates may require annual servicing. Environmental factors like dust, pollen, and pollution increase wear and clog components faster. If you live in a dusty or humid area, schedule service more often to prevent buildup that reduces efficiency and inflates energy costs.

Recommended Service Intervals for Different AC Types

Different AC types require specific service intervals to maintain efficiency and longevity. Understanding these intervals helps you schedule maintenance that fits your unit’s design and usage.

Central Air Conditioning Systems

Central AC systems demand annual servicing to keep all components functioning properly. You should schedule maintenance once a year before peak cooling seasons. During service, technicians inspect refrigerant levels, clean coils, check electrical connections, and replace filters. If you live in dusty or humid areas or use the system heavily, consider semi-annual checks to prevent performance drops.

Window and Portable AC Units

Window and portable AC units benefit from annual servicing to ensure optimal airflow and cooling. Clean or replace filters every three months during use to reduce strain. Service intervals include coil cleaning, electrical inspections, and drainage system checks. Frequent usage or environments with high dust levels warrant more frequent filter maintenance, but full service remains effective at a yearly pace.

Ductless Mini-Split Systems

Ductless mini-split systems require biannual servicing due to their unique design and usage patterns. You should schedule maintenance twice a year, ideally before summer and winter. Technicians clean indoor and outdoor units, inspect refrigerant charge, and test electrical components to maintain peak efficiency. If usage intensifies or environmental dust increases, additional filter cleaning between services becomes necessary.

Key Tasks Included in an AC Service

An AC service covers essential tasks that maintain efficiency and prevent breakdowns. Each task targets a specific component to ensure your system performs reliably.

Cleaning and Replacing Filters

Cleaning and replacing filters removes dust, dirt, and allergens, which block airflow and reduce cooling efficiency. Your filters typically need replacement every 1 to 3 months, but a service technician inspects them during routine maintenance to decide if cleaning or replacement suits your system’s condition best.

Checking Refrigerant Levels

Checking refrigerant levels detects leaks or deficiencies that cause poor cooling and system strain. Your technician measures pressure and refills refrigerant only if low, ensuring compliance with environmental regulations and optimal performance.

Inspecting Electrical Components

Inspecting electrical components identifies loose connections, worn wires, and faulty capacitors that risk system failure or fire hazards. Your technician tests the thermostat, contactors, and breakers to confirm safe and efficient operation, tightening or replacing parts as needed.

Signs Your AC Needs Immediate Servicing

Unusual noises like grinding, squealing, or rattling indicate mechanical issues requiring prompt attention. Poor airflow from vents signals clogged filters or blocked ducts that reduce system efficiency. Warm air blowing instead of cool air often points to refrigerant leaks or compressor problems that degrade cooling performance. Excessive moisture or water pooling near the unit suggests drainage issues that can lead to mold growth and damage. Frequent cycling on and off reveals thermostat malfunctions or electrical faults impacting system reliability. Unpleasant odors, such as burning or musty smells, warn of electrical hazards or mold buildup that affect indoor air quality. Sudden spikes in energy bills often reflect declining AC efficiency needing professional inspection to prevent costly repairs.
